Lincoln Minster School - Governance

The legal governing body for Lincoln Minster School is the United Church Schools Trust (UCST). The Trust is the body ultimately responsible for the proper operation of the school.

A Local Governing Body is in place at Lincoln Minster School. This body reviews local issues and meets with the Principal and other staff as necessary. The Chair may be contacted via the School email address enquiries.lincoln@church-schools.com

The United Church Schools Trust
UCST is a Christian educational charity founded in 1883. The company owns nine other schools in the country and has a reputation for forward thinking and quality management.

The UCST objective for each pupil is to become a balanced, interesting person with intellectual freedom to be creative to gain confidence to initiate to develop resilience to cope with adversity to express Christian belief in service to others to be equipped to think for themselves and to gain a love of learning as a lifelong process.
